The Messenger of Allah ﷺ said, "In Paradise there is a tree so vast that a rider could travel in its shade for a hundred years without crossing it."
عن رسول الله ﷺ قال: إن في الجنة لشجرة يسير الراكب في ظلها مائة عام لا يقطعها.
Muslim narrated it in the Book of Paradise (2827) from Ishaq bin Ibrahim Hanzali, "Makhzumi (that is, Mughira bin Salama) informed us, Wahib narrated to us, from Abu Hazim, from Sahl bin Saad," and he related it.Bukhari narrated it in the Book of Riqaq (6552), saying, "Ishaq bin Ibrahim said, with his chain." Its apparent form suggests a suspended narration, but his statement is to be understood as connected, since Ishaq was one of his teachers.
